 public static void ChangeCoordinateSystem(IGeodatabaseRelease igeodatabaseRelease_0,
                                           ISpatialReference ispatialReference_0, bool bool_0)
 {
     if (ispatialReference_0 != null)
     {
         bool geoDatasetPrecision            = GeodatabaseTools.GetGeoDatasetPrecision(igeodatabaseRelease_0);
         IControlPrecision2 controlPrecision = ispatialReference_0 as IControlPrecision2;
         if (controlPrecision.IsHighPrecision != geoDatasetPrecision)
         {
             controlPrecision.IsHighPrecision = geoDatasetPrecision;
             double num;
             double num2;
             double num3;
             double num4;
             ispatialReference_0.GetDomain(out num, out num2, out num3, out num4);
             if (bool_0)
             {
                 ISpatialReferenceResolution spatialReferenceResolution =
                     ispatialReference_0 as ISpatialReferenceResolution;
                 spatialReferenceResolution.ConstructFromHorizon();
                 spatialReferenceResolution.SetDefaultXYResolution();
                 ISpatialReferenceTolerance spatialReferenceTolerance =
                     ispatialReference_0 as ISpatialReferenceTolerance;
                 spatialReferenceTolerance.SetDefaultXYTolerance();
             }
         }
     }
 }
